What to check before for buildings near the B train in Homecrest

  • Expect listings across different building types within the Homecrest area—use the B-train scope as your baseline, then refine by amenities and availability on the building pages.
  • Before you sign, confirm the full move-in cost: deposit amount, any required fees, and whether utilities are included or metered.
  • If a building looks “similar” in photos, verify real-life constraints during the tour or with management (laundry setup, elevator status, package handling, and noise/ventilation).
  • Check whether the unit you want is actually available right now on Openigloo, since availability can change quickly.
  • Use tenant Q&A and building signals as a starting point, then ask the landlord about any item you see mentioned—especially repairs and turnaround time.
